What is Human Resource Management?

Human Resource Management is the art of attracting, recruiting, training, developing and retaining talent, contributing to creating an effective and productive working environment.

Human Resource Management is a specialized training program in Human Resource Management in enterprises. Students are equipped with the necessary knowledge and skills to be able to perform practical tasks in the human resource profession such as: human resource planning, recruitment, training and development, staff planning, building a compensation regime...

What to do after graduating from Human Resource Management, where to work, how much salary?

Doing what?

Human Resource Management graduates can take on the following job positions:

  • Recruiter: Search, attract and evaluate candidates suitable for the job vacancy.
  • Training and Development Specialist: Design and implement training and capacity development programs for employees
  • Labor Relations Manager: Handle issues related to labor law, benefits, and labor disputes.
  • Human Resources Consultant: Providing advice on human resources strategy, performance management, and corporate culture building.
  • Lecturer: Teaching in universities, colleges, etc.

The increasing demand for human resources in Human Resource Management opens up many job opportunities for students.

Where?

After graduation, Bachelor of Human Resource Management can work at domestic and foreign agencies and organizations:

  • Businesses: Companies and corporations in all sectors, from manufacturing, services to non-profits.
  • State agencies: Ministries, branches, government agencies at all levels.
  • Non-governmental organizations: Non-profit, international organizations working in the field of human resources.
  • Consulting company: Providing human resource management consulting services to human resource businesses

How much salary?

The starting salary for new graduates in Human Resource Management ranges from 10 to 12 million VND/month. However, this figure will vary depending on ability, experience and specific recruitment position. For students with excellent ability, good academic performance and internship experience, the starting salary can be higher than 12 million VND/month.

In terms of development potential, the Human Resources Management industry offers wide-open promotion opportunities for those who are passionate and dedicated. For management and senior expert positions, salaries can reach up to several tens of millions of VND/month.
